Korean BBQ Meatballs Recipe
If you love bold flavors and crave a dish that delivers a perfect bite every time, these Korean BBQ Meatballs are about to become your new favorite. Juicy, tender meatballs infused with a harmonious blend of garlic, ginger, and that iconic Korean chili paste known as gochujang create an irresistible combination. Each bite offers a balance of sweet, savory, and spicy notes that will have you reaching for seconds and sharing this recipe with everyone you know. Whether for a casual dinner or a crowd-pleasing appetizer, Korean BBQ Meatballs bring warmth and excitement to your table in the most delicious way.

Ingredients You’ll Need
These ingredients are straightforward but incredibly essential to capturing the authentic flavor and texture that make Korean BBQ Meatballs so delightful. Every component, from the savory soy sauce to the spicy gochujang, works together to create a lively, mouthwatering experience.
- Ground beef: The foundation for juicy, meaty meatballs with rich flavor.
- Garlic: Freshly minced for a pungent aroma that boosts every bite.
- Ginger: Grated to add a subtle zing and freshness that complements the spice.
- Green onions: Finely chopped for a mild crunch and hint of sharpness.
- Egg: Acts as a binder to keep the meatballs moist and together.
- Breadcrumbs: Adds structure and prevents the meatballs from falling apart.
- Soy sauce: Brings umami depth and salty sweetness.
- Sesame oil: Infuses a nutty richness that is signature in Korean cooking.
- Gochujang (Korean chili paste): Provides that essential spicy kick and a touch of sweetness.
- Brown sugar: Balances the heat with just the right amount of sweetness.
- Rice vinegar: Adds subtle acidity to brighten the flavors.
- Cornstarch (optional): Helps bind meatballs more firmly, especially if your mixture feels wet.
- Salt and black pepper: Essential seasoning to enhance all other flavors.
- Toasted sesame seeds: Sprinkle on top for a toasty crunch and visual appeal.
- Chopped scallions: A fresh garnish that brings vibrant color and mild oniony taste.
- Spicy Mayo Dip ingredients: Mayonnaise, gochujang, lime juice, and honey combine to create a creamy, tangy sauce that pairs wonderfully with the meatballs.
How to Make Korean BBQ Meatballs
Step 1: Preparing the Mixture
Start by gathering your ingredients so everything is within reach. In a large mixing bowl, combine the ground beef with the minced garlic, grated ginger, and finely chopped green onions. Then, crack in the egg, add the breadcrumbs, soy sauce, sesame oil, and the star of the dish — gochujang. Stir in the brown sugar and rice vinegar. Season everything with salt and black pepper to taste. If you want extra assurance that your meatballs will hold together nicely, sprinkle in the cornstarch. Mix gently but thoroughly, just until everything is evenly combined without overworking the meat, to keep the meatballs tender.
Step 2: Shaping the Meatballs
Using your hands, form the mixture into uniform 1-inch meatballs. Keeping them around this size ensures they cook evenly and make for perfect bite-sized treats. Place each meatball on a baking sheet lined with parchment paper to prevent sticking and create an easy cleanup.
Step 3: Baking to Perfection
Preheat your oven to 400°F (200°C). Pop the tray of meatballs in and bake for about 18 to 20 minutes, until they are fully cooked through and beautifully browned on the outside. The aroma that fills your kitchen during this time hints at just how amazing these Korean BBQ Meatballs will taste.
Step 4: Preparing the Spicy Mayo Dip
While your meatballs are baking, whip up the spicy mayo dip to add a creamy, cooling contrast. In a small bowl, whisk together mayonnaise, gochujang, lime juice, and honey until smooth and creamy. This dip is a fantastic complement to the savory, spicy meatballs and will quickly become a favorite condiment to have on hand.
How to Serve Korean BBQ Meatballs

Garnishes
To really elevate the presentation and flavor, sprinkle toasted sesame seeds over the warm meatballs right before serving. Add chopped scallions to bring freshness, color, and that lovely mild onion bite. These simple garnishes not only make the dish look irresistible but also add subtle textural contrasts that our taste buds love.
Side Dishes
Korean BBQ Meatballs shine as the star of a meal but pair beautifully with light and fresh side dishes too. Consider serving them alongside steamed jasmine rice or fluffy Korean sticky rice to soak up any delicious sauce. A crunchy cucumber salad dressed with a sesame-soy vinaigrette or quick-pickled radishes is a genius way to balance the richness with crisp, tangy notes.
Creative Ways to Present
If you want to impress guests or refresh your weeknight rotation, try threading these meatballs onto skewers with pieces of bell peppers and onions for a colorful Korean BBQ-inspired kebab. Or pile them into lettuce cups topped with a drizzle of the spicy mayo and extra scallions for a fun and interactive bite that’s bursting with flavor in every mouthful.
Make Ahead and Storage
Storing Leftovers
Leftover Korean BBQ Meatballs keep beautifully in an airtight container in the fridge for up to 3 days. They’re perfect for quick lunches or a speedy dinner—just add a fresh garnish and reheat gently to revive their deliciousness.
Freezing
You can freeze cooked meatballs by placing them on a baking sheet to freeze individually first, then transferring to a freezer-safe bag or container. This way they won’t stick together. Frozen Korean BBQ Meatballs last up to 3 months and make for a convenient, flavorful meal any day.
Reheating
To reheat, warm the meatballs in a 350°F (175°C) oven for about 10 minutes or until heated through. You can also microwave them, but the oven method helps keep that delightful outer texture intact. Serve with fresh garnishes and the spicy mayo dip for a quick meal that tastes like it’s freshly made.
FAQs
Can I use ground chicken or turkey instead of beef?
Absolutely! Ground chicken or turkey can be used for a leaner alternative. Just be mindful that they may require a bit more seasoning or moisture, so consider adding an extra egg or some grated vegetables to keep the meatballs juicy.
How spicy are these Korean BBQ Meatballs?
The spiciness mainly comes from the gochujang and the optional spicy mayo dip. Gochujang has a mild to medium heat with a sweet undertone, so the heat is balanced rather than overwhelming. You can adjust the amount of gochujang to suit your heat preference.
Can I make these meatballs without breadcrumbs?
Yes, you can omit breadcrumbs for a gluten-free version and use alternatives like crushed rice crackers or ground oats to help bind the meatballs. Just remember that breadcrumbs also add softness, so your meatballs might be a bit denser without them.
Is it necessary to bake the meatballs? Can they be fried?
Baking is easier and less messy, and it yields evenly cooked meatballs with a lovely browned exterior. However, you can pan-fry the meatballs in a little oil over medium heat until cooked through, which adds a wonderful caramelized crust and faster cooking time.
What can I serve with Korean BBQ Meatballs for an easy party appetizer?
Serve these meatballs toothpick-style with small dipping bowls of the spicy mayo. Pair with a bright cucumber salad or pickled veggies to balance flavors, and add some steamed rice or noodles on the side for guests who want a fuller bite.
Final Thoughts
There’s something incredibly comforting and exciting about Korean BBQ Meatballs that just makes you want to smile after every bite. Their bold, layered flavors combined with easy preparation make them perfect for busy weeknights or special gatherings. Don’t wait to give this recipe a try — you might just find yourself making these irresistible meatballs again and again, sharing the love one flavorful bite at a time.
PrintKorean BBQ Meatballs Recipe
These Korean BBQ Meatballs are a flavorful fusion dish combining tender ground beef with authentic Korean ingredients like gochujang and sesame oil. Baked to perfection and served with a creamy, spicy mayo dip, they make a perfect appetizer or party snack that’s both easy to prepare and deliciously satisfying.
- Prep Time: 15 minutes
- Cook Time: 20 minutes
- Total Time: 35 minutes
- Yield: About 20 meatballs 1x
- Category: Appetizer
- Method: Baking
- Cuisine: Korean
- Diet: Halal
Ingredients
Meatballs
- 1 lb ground beef
- 2 cloves garlic, minced
- 1/2 inch ginger, grated
- 2 green onions, finely chopped
- 1 egg
- 1/4 cup breadcrumbs
- 2 tablespoons soy sauce
- 1 tablespoon sesame oil
- 1 tablespoon gochujang (Korean chili paste)
- 1 tablespoon brown sugar
- 1 teaspoon rice vinegar
- 1 teaspoon cornstarch (optional, for binding)
- Salt and black pepper to taste
- Toasted sesame seeds and chopped scallions for garnish
Spicy Mayo Dip
- 1/2 cup mayonnaise
- 1 tablespoon gochujang
- 1 teaspoon lime juice
- 1/2 teaspoon honey
Instructions
- Preheat the oven: Set your oven to 400°F (200°C) and line a baking sheet with parchment paper to prevent sticking and for easy cleanup.
- Mix the meatball ingredients: In a large mixing bowl, combine ground beef, minced garlic, grated ginger, chopped green onions, egg, breadcrumbs, soy sauce, sesame oil, gochujang, brown sugar, rice vinegar, salt, and black pepper. If using, add cornstarch for extra binding. Mix everything thoroughly until well combined.
- Form the meatballs: Shape the mixture into 1-inch meatballs using your hands or a small scoop, ensuring they are uniform in size for even cooking.
- Bake the meatballs: Arrange the meatballs on the prepared baking sheet, spacing them evenly. Bake for 18 to 20 minutes, or until they are fully cooked through and nicely browned on the outside.
- Prepare the spicy mayo dip: While the meatballs are baking, whisk together mayonnaise, gochujang, lime juice, and honey in a small bowl until smooth and creamy.
- Serve: Once cooked, serve the meatballs warm. Drizzle with the spicy mayo dip or serve it on the side. Garnish the meatballs with toasted sesame seeds and chopped scallions for added flavor and texture.
Notes
- For a gluten-free version, substitute soy sauce with tamari and use gluten-free breadcrumbs.
- You can swap ground beef for ground turkey or chicken for a leaner option.
- If you prefer a spicier meatball, increase the gochujang amount to 1.5 tablespoons.
- The cornstarch is optional but helps keep meatballs intact and juicy.
- Make sure not to overmix the meatball mixture to prevent tough meatballs.
- Leftover meatballs can be refrigerated for up to 3 days or frozen for up to 1 month.
Nutrition
- Serving Size: 4 meatballs with sauce (approx. 120g)
- Calories: 320 kcal
- Sugar: 5 g
- Sodium: 650 mg
- Fat: 20 g
- Saturated Fat: 7 g
- Unsaturated Fat: 10 g
- Trans Fat: 0.1 g
- Carbohydrates: 15 g
- Fiber: 1.5 g
- Protein: 18 g
- Cholesterol: 85 mg
Keywords: Korean BBQ meatballs, Korean appetizer, gochujang meatballs, spicy mayo dip, party appetizers, easy Korean recipes